“Tyrant’s Tool”: Former FBI Head James Comey’s Daughter Dismissed by Trump | Donald Trump News

Following his firing as a federal prosecutor, Mohren Comey called on his colleagues to condemn “power abuse.”

Mauren Comey, the daughter of former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) director James Comey, blamed President Donald Trump shortly after being fired from his role as a federal prosecutor in the United States.

In a memo to a colleague obtained by the Associated Press on Thursday, Comey wrote, “If a career prosecutor could be fired for no reason, fear could permeate the decisions of those who remain.”

“Don’t let that happen,” she said. “Fear is a tyrant’s tool and acts to restrain independent thinking.”

The memo came the day after Comey was let go of her role from her role as the Department of Justice’s New York US Attorney Assistant.

The Trump administration has yet to provide a reason for Comey’s firing. However, her position has long been seen as vulnerable due to her relationship with her father, who oversaw an investigation into alleged collusion between Trump’s campaign and Russia in the 2016 presidential election.

Elder Comey was fired by Trump early in his first term, but the former FBI director continues to be the subject of the president’s rage.

In Congressional testimony and a 2018 book, James Comey denounced Trump’s “unethical” and mafia-like approach to leadership. He also argued that Trump’s decision to fire him was an effort to undermine Russian investigations.

Since taking office in his second term, Trump and his allies have tried to purge Justice Department employees involved in cases of his opposition.

They include prosecutors who worked on the prosecution of special advisor Jack Smith as they pursued two federal criminal charges against Trump. One is to withhold documents classified during his tenure, and the other is to destroy the 2020 election.

Both lawsuits were dropped when Trump was re-elected in November 2024. It opposes the Justice Department’s policy of prosecuting sitting presidents.

The Associated Press reported earlier this month that more career prosecutors and support staff involved in Smith’s indictment had finished their jobs.

Critics argue that the Trump administration’s decision to fire such employees has eroded the Department of Justice’s independence. Many also point out that career civil servants do not choose to file their lawsuits and instead serve even when the presidential administration is in office, regardless of politics.

In a message to her colleagues, Mohren Comey urged her prosecutors to fight their current plight more diligently for a fair and impartial rule of law.

“Instead of fear,” she wrote.

“The fire of justice digging against the abuse of power. A commitment to seek justice for the victims. Above all, a commitment to the truth.”

Veteran Lawyer

Before her firing, Molen Comey was a veteran lawyer for the Southern District of New York and was often considered one of the nation’s top prosecutors’ offices.

She recently indicted Sean “Diddy” Combs. This is when a music producer pleads guilty to transport for intent to prostitution, but is acquitted of conspiracy and sex trafficking.

She previously worked on the success of Gislaine Maxwell’s prosecutor on charges of sex trafficking in connection with the sexual abuse of a minor girl by financier Jeffrey Epstein.

The fire comes as Attorney General Pam Bondy faces criticism from Trump’s Make America Great (MAGA) base in order to not release more evidence related to Epstein, including full accounting for his “client list.”

Epstein died of suicide in 2019 at the Manhattan Detention Center.

Several influential right-wing internet personalities, including Laura Loomer, have attacked Bondi and are seeking to fire Comey.

Additionally, US media reports that the Trump administration is currently investigating James Comey and former Intelligence Agency (CIA) John Brennan about an investigation into Russian interference in the 2016 election.

At the time, the US intelligence news community concluded that Russia was trying to interfere in the election, but there was not enough evidence to support the allegations that Trump’s campaign was trying to conspire with Russian agents.

Details of the reported probes to Comey and Brennan have not been revealed.
